Denver, CO vs Wichita, KS
Side-by-side fiscal comparison · U.S. Census Bureau data (2023)
Summary
Denver spends 320.5% more per capita than Wichita ($25,596/person difference). Wichita, KS has the stronger Fiscal Health Score (A, 90/100).
